Investigating climate-change effects on mine tailings

Research supported by NSERC Alliance and Mitacs Accelerate examines climate-related changes in tailings stability and flow-liquefaction potential.
Advancing groundwater knowledge in the Chisasibi sector

PACES research combines field measurements, laboratory analyses, remote sensing, and AI to strengthen groundwater knowledge in the Cree Nation territory.
Developing tools to map groundwater quality in Québec

A MELCCFP-supported project is developing cartographic tools to communicate groundwater quality and natural geochemical conditions across Québec.
Sharing groundwater knowledge with the Cree Nation in Eeyou Istchee

A collaborative project brings together community priorities, Indigenous knowledge, and hydrogeological information to support groundwater understanding and protection.
Assessing wildfire impacts on Québec’s boreal aquatic ecosystems

An EcotoQ-supported project examines post-fire contaminants, water and sediment quality, and risks to aquatic ecosystems.
CentrEau-supported research investigates groundwater drought propagation

UQAT and McGill researchers are developing interpretable deep-learning approaches to understand groundwater drought and climate-related risks.
AI-powered water modelling in boreal forests after wildfires

An NSERC Discovery project led by Rahim Barzegar investigates how wildfire changes water resources in boreal forests.
Ouranos project: modelling groundwater recharge and low flows under climate change

The Ouranos–MELCCFP QClim’Eau project brings physics-informed graph neural networks to groundwater recharge and river low-flow modelling in Québec.
